:root{--color-primary: #ffffff;--color-second: #1e2229;--color-acento: #683400;--color-focus: #01effa;--color-fondo: #13161c;--color-texto-primary: #01effa;--color-texto-second: #ffffff;--color-texto-paragraph: #000000;--color-boton-primary: #01effa;--color-boton-hover-primary: #3d777a;--color-boton-second: #1a1a1a;--color-boton-hover-second: #2c2c2c;--color-boton-alert: #eb0000;--color-boton-hover-alert: #9e0101;--color-boton-normal: #ffffff;--color-boton-hover-normal: #2c3442;--color-fondo-card: #ffffff;--color-borde-card: #e0e0e0;--sidebar-dark-primary: #023538;--sidebar-dark-secondary: #2c3e50;--sidebar-light-primary: #f5f6fa;--navbar-light-secondary: #8392a5;--sidebar-item-hover: rgba(255, 255, 255, .1);--sidebar-item-active: rgba(255, 255, 255, .2)}body{font-family:Arial,sans-serif;background:var(--color-fondo);color:var(--color-texto-second);line-height:1.6;margin:0;padding:20px}#app{display:flex;flex-direction:column;min-height:100vh}.app-container{margin-left:280px;padding:60px 20px 20px;transition:margin-left .3s ease;display:grid;grid-template-columns:1fr;gap:20px}.column{padding:10px}.wide{grid-column:span 2}.extrawide{grid-column:span 3}@media (max-width: 768px){.app-container{margin-left:0}}@media (min-width: 769px){.app-container{grid-template-columns:repeat(3,1fr)}}@media (min-width: 1024px){.app-container{grid-template-columns:repeat(4,1fr)}}h1,h2,h3{color:var(--color-texto-second)}input{background-color:transparent;border:0px;border-bottom:1px solid #ccc;padding:5px;width:100%;height:40px;font-size:1rem;color:var(--color-primary);outline:none;transition:border-color .3s ease}input:focus{border:1px solid var(--color-focus);border-radius:5px}.button-container{display:flex;justify-content:center;align-items:center;gap:15px;flex-wrap:wrap;padding:20px}button{width:200px;height:50px;font-size:1rem;border:none;cursor:pointer;transition:background-color .3s ease,transform .3s ease;padding:10px 20px;border-radius:5px}.error-message{color:red;background:#ff00001a;padding:3px 5px;border-radius:4px;margin-top:3px;display:inline-block;font-size:.8rem}.btn-primary button{background-color:var(--color-boton-primary);color:#000}.btn-primary button:hover{background-color:var(--color-boton-hover-primary);transform:scale(1.05)}.btn-primary button:active{transform:scale(.98)}.btn-second button{background-color:var(--color-boton-second);color:#fff}.btn-second button:hover{background-color:var(--color-boton-hover-second);transform:scale(1.05)}.btn-second button:active{transform:scale(.98)}.btn-alert button{background-color:var(--color-boton-alert);color:#fff}.btn-alert button:hover{background-color:var(--color-boton-hover-alert);transform:scale(1.05)}.btn-alert button:active{transform:scale(.98)}.btn-normal button{background-color:var(--color-boton-normal);color:#000}.btn-normal button:hover{background-color:var(--color-boton-hover-normal);color:#fff;transform:scale(1.05)}.btn-normal button:active{transform:scale(.98)}.button-container,.button-container-row{display:flex;flex-direction:column;gap:10px}.button-container-row{flex-direction:row}.container-card{width:90%;max-width:1200px;padding:20px;background-color:var(--color-fondo-card);box-shadow:0 0 10px #0000001a;border:1px solid var(--color-borde-card);border-radius:8px;font-family:Courier,monospace;color:var(--color-texto-paragraph)}
